Adjunct Professor Of Biology
I taught the laboratory course for Foundations of Biology and Scientific Inquiry I in the fall of 2021. There were four key objectives for this course: 1) help students develop an understanding of and be able to perform the scientific method 2) teach students how to design and perform experiments 3) explain how to objectively analyze data using statistics 4) promote students to think critically about data and demonstrate how to report findings in the format of a formal scientific paper.In the spring of 2022, I taught the laboratory component of the Biology of Human Concern class. The objectives of this course were to 1) understand the fundamentals of scientific thought and methodology 2) understand the cellular basis of life 3) understand the basics of human anatomy and physiology and 4) relate the above concepts to contemporary issues and problems concerning disease.
Course Teaching Assistant
I was a a teaching assistant for both the 2019 and 2021 iterations of the Cold Spring Harbor course "Drosophila Neurobiology: Genes, Circuits, and Behavior”. This is a laboratory/lecture course intended for researchers at all levels from beginning graduate students through established primary investigators who use Drosophila as an experimental system for nervous system investigation. This three-week course introduces students to a wide variety of topics and techniques, including the latest approaches for studying nervous system development, activity, and connectivity, as well as complex behaviors and disease models.
